NOTE
The headlights, other exterior lights and instrument panel illumination may not turn
l
off immediately even if the surrounding area becomes well-lit because the light sensor
determines that it is nighttime if the surrounding area is continuously dark for several
minutes such as inside long tunnels, traffic jams inside tunnels, or in indoor parking
lots.
In this case, the light turns off if the light switch is turned to the OFF position.
The instrument panel illumination can be adjusted by rotating the knob in the
l
instrument cluster. To adjust the brightness of the instrument panel illumination: Refer
to Instrument Panel Illumination on page 5-41.
When the headlight switch is in the AUTO position and the ignition is switched to
l
ACC or the ignition is switched off, the headlights, other exterior lights and
instrument panel illumination will turn off.
The sensitivity of the AUTO lights may be changed by an Authorised Mazda
l
Repairer.
qLights-On Reminder
If lights are on and the ignition is
switched to ACC or the ignition is
switched off, or the key is removed from
the ignition switch, a continuous beep
sound will be heard when the driver's
door is opened.

qHeadlight High-Low Beam
Press the lever forward to turn on the high
beams.
Pull the lever back to its original position
for the low beams.
